Five years hence the age of money should be three times that of his son 5 years ago manish age was seven times that of his son what are their present ages

Answer:let money 's age be x

Let son 's age be y.

ATQ five years hence

Money age =x+5

Son age =y+5 then

X+5= 3( y+5)

X+5= 3y+15

x-3y=10.let equation (a)

And then

X-5=7(y-5)

X-5= 7y-35

X-7y =-30 let equation b.

Then solve equation a and b by elimination method

X-7y=-30

X-3y=10

_ + -

-4y =- 40

Y= 10 so present age of son is 10 years

Put value of y I equation a then find value of x

X-3y=10

X-3( 10) = 10

X-30=10

X= 40

So present age of father is 40 years.
